The background reveals a townscape nestled against rolling hills. Buildings, rendered in warm hues of orange and yellow, are illuminated against the darkening sky, suggesting either dusk or an artificial lighting scheme. Palm trees punctuate the skyline, reinforcing a tropical locale. The mountains in the distance are silhouetted against a vibrant sunset – or sunrise – characterized by intense reds and oranges that transition into deep blues overhead.
The artist’s use of color is striking; the cool tones of the water and sky contrast sharply with the warmth emanating from the town, creating visual tension and drawing attention to the central action. The dark border framing the scene isolates it, enhancing its sense of theatricality and emphasizing the artificial nature of the composition – it feels staged rather than observed directly.
Subtextually, the painting seems to explore themes of power, freedom, and the relationship between humanity and nature. The whale’s breach can be interpreted as a symbol of untamed force or liberation, while the sailing ship represents human ambition and exploration. The presence of the dolphin suggests harmony within this ecosystem. The town itself might symbolize civilization encroaching upon the natural world, though the warm lighting implies a degree of comfort and prosperity. Overall, the work conveys a sense of awe and wonder at the beauty and power of the ocean environment, while also hinting at the complexities of human interaction with it.
